What Are IGCSE Physics 0625 Past Papers?
Before comparing strategies, it is important to understand what IGCSE Physics 0625 past papers actually offer.
These are complete exam papers from previous years. They include all sections of the exam, such as multiple choice, structured questions, and practical-based questions.
Students use IGCSE Physics 0625 past papers to:
- Understand exam format
- Practice real questions
- Improve time management
- Test their knowledge
They are an essential part of exam preparation.
What Are Topic Questions?
Topic questions are collections of exam questions arranged by subject area, such as motion, electricity, or waves.
Unlike IGCSE Physics 0625 past papers, topic questions allow students to focus on one concept at a time.
This method is useful for:
- Learning new topics
- Practicing weak areas
- Building a strong understanding
Both methods have their own benefits.

Benefits of IGCSE Physics 0625 Past Papers
Using IGCSE Physics 0625 past papers offers several key advantages.
First, they help students understand how questions are structured. This reduces surprises in the actual exam.
Second, they improve time management. Students learn how to divide time between questions.
Third, they help identify weak areas. After solving a paper, students can see which topics need more attention.
These benefits make past papers a powerful study tool.
Limitations of Using Only Past Papers
Although IGCSE Physics 0625 past papers are very useful, they are not enough on their own.
One major limitation is the lack of focused practice. Students may not get enough repetition for difficult topics.
Another issue is uneven coverage. Some topics appear less frequently in past papers, so that students may ignore them.
Also, beginners may find full papers too difficult without prior topic understanding.

Combining Both Methods for Best Results
The best strategy is not to choose between methods but to combine them.
Students should use topic questions first to understand concepts, then move to IGCSE Physics 0625 past papers for full exam practice.
A balanced approach includes:
- Learning topics through focused practice
- Testing knowledge with full papers
- Reviewing mistakes regularly
This combination leads to better performance.
When to Use Topic Questions
Topic questions should be used during the early stages of preparation.
At this point, students are still learning the syllabus and need a strong foundation before attempting IGCSE Physics 0625 past papers.
They help in:
- Understanding key concepts
- Practicing specific skills
- Building confidence
When to Use Past Papers
IGCSE Physics 0625 past papers should be used after completing most of the syllabus.
At this stage, students are ready to:
- Practice full exam papers
- Improve speed and accuracy
- Prepare for real exam conditions
This phase is important for final revision.
